CHOIR: Killarney School of Music's new StageWorks Choir will be directed by Siobhain Bustin.

Killarney School of Music is excited to announce the launch of their new StageWorks Choir - to develop all aspects of achieving excellence in live stage performance.

The new choir will be directed by Siobhain Bustin, who has recently come on-board with the Killarney School of Music. Piano accompaniment is provided by Miriam Fell.

“The aim of StageWorks is to develop all aspects of achieving excellence in live stage performance,” Tadhg Buckley from the school said.

“This will include working with live accompaniment, vocal arrangements, harmony, use of amplification, audience interaction and more. Siobhain, who recently played the lead role of Maria in ‘The Sound of Music’ with Killarney Musical Society, has a particular passion for developing students’ confidence and the vocal stamina needed for live performances. She also brings a wealth of performance experience and has studied singing for over 12 years.”

Live performances are an integral part of StageWorks, he added.

“Students will have the opportunity to perform concert style productions in quality venues to attentive audiences in the Killarney vicinity.”

Killarney National Park will serve as the venue for this year’s Kerry Alzheimer’s Memory Walk on Sunday, September 20.

Participants will gather at the Deenagh Lodge ahead of an 11.00am start to complete a 5km scenic route through the park.

The event takes place on the eve of World Alzheimer’s Day as part of a nationwide series of walks supported by Aviva.


Now in its seventh year, the initiative raises vital funds for The Alzheimer Society of Ireland to support local dementia services, including daycare centres, family carer training, social clubs, dementia cafés, and the national helpline.

Last year, nearly 3,000 walkers across Ireland raised over €240,000 for the cause.


The Kerry walk will be led by local champions Kathriona Sheehan, Niamh Murphy, Lynda Phillips, and Melissa Molyneaux, who are walking in support of all those living with dementia.
“We are proud to lead our annual Alzheimer’s Memory Walk supported by Aviva to help fund local dementia services in Kerry,” they said. “The event is about community and helping spread awareness by walking together to raise vital funds for care, support, and hope for the days ahead. Join us in Killarney on Sunday, 20th September to show your support.”


With over 40 walks scheduled across Ireland, members of the public can walk in memory of a loved one or to show solidarity. Further details and registration are available at memorywalk.ie.

Style reigned supreme at Killarney Racecourse as local resident Gary Moynihan and Offaly’s Sylwia Novak captured the top honours at the Canella Lane Best Dressed Day.

Moynihan, a local neuromuscular therapist, claimed Best Dressed Gentleman in a made-to-measure six-button burgundy double-breasted suit with a navy check from Saville Menswear in Cork. He completed the winning look with a shirt and paisley tie from Simply Suits Killarney and brown derby shoes from Pavers at the Killarney Outlet Centre.
Best Dressed Lady was awarded to Novak, a hospital personal assistant from Tullamore, who wore a red polka-dot ensemble and custom hat designed by milliner Rita Daly, featuring sustainable jewellery made from recycled plastic.
Canella Lane owner Ciana Aspell praised the high standard of fashion on the day, while Killarney Racecourse Manager Karl McCay thanked the sponsors and racegoers for their support.
With the summer season now wrapped up, the team at Killarney Racecourse is gearing up for the October Festival on October 4 and 5, featuring its first-ever Student Raceday with SPIN South West on the Monday. Early ticket booking is advised.
